- Title
Associations between Physical Activity and Obesity Defined by Waist-To-Height Ratio and Body Mass Index in the Korean Population.

- Abstract
Objective: This study investigated the associations between physical activity and the prevalence of obesity determined by waist-to-height ratio (WHtR) and body mass index (BMI). Methods: This is the first study to our knowledge on physical activity and obesity using a nationally representative sample of South Korean population from The Korea National Health and Nutrition Examination Survey. We categorized individuals into either non-obese or obese defined by WHtR and BMI. Levels of moderate-to-vigorous physical activity were classified as ‘Inactive’, ‘Active’, and ‘Very active’ groups based on the World Health Organization physical activity guidelines. Multivariable logistic regression was used to examine the associations between physical activity and the prevalence of obesity. Results: Physical activity was significantly associated with a lower prevalence of obesity using both WHtR and BMI. Compared to inactive men, odds ratios (ORs) (95% confidence intervals [CIs]) for obesity by WHtR ≥0.50 were 0.69 (0.53–0.89) in active men and 0.76 (0.63–0.91) in very active men (p for trend = 0.007). The ORs (95% CIs) for obesity by BMI ≥25 kg/m2 were 0.78 (0.59–1.03) in active men and 0.82 (0.67–0.99) in very active men (p for trend = 0.060). The ORs (95% CIs) for obesity by BMI ≥30 kg/m2 were 0.40 (0.15–0.98) in active men and 0.90 (0.52–1.56) in very active men (p for trend = 0.978). Compared to inactive women, the ORs (95% CIs) for obesity by WHtR ≥0.50 were 0.94 (0.75–1.18) in active women and 0.84 (0.71–0.998) in very active women (p for trend = 0.046). However, no significant associations were found between physical activity and obesity by BMI in women. Conclusions: We found more significant associations between physical activity and obesity defined by WHtR than BMI. However, intervention studies are warranted to investigate and compare causal associations between physical activity and different obesity measures in various populations.
